大肠杆菌阳性调节因子OmpR在假定的RNA聚合酶相互作用位点处具有一个大的环状结构。

Escherichia coli positive regulator OmpR has a large loop structure at the putative RNA polymerase interaction site.

作者信息

Kondo H, Nakagawa A, Nishihira J, Nishimura Y, Mizuno T, Tanaka I

出版信息

Nat Struct Biol. 1997 Jan;4(1):28-31. doi: 10.1038/nsb0197-28.

DOI:10.1038/nsb0197-28
PMID:8989318
Abstract

The C-terminal DNA-binding domain of OmpR, a positive regulator involved in osmoregulation expression of the ompF and ompC genes in Escherichia coli, has a helix-turn-helix variant motif. The 'turn' region, consisting of 11 residues, forms an RNA polymerase contact site.

摘要

OmpR是一种参与大肠杆菌中ompF和ompC基因渗透调节表达的正调控因子,其C端DNA结合结构域具有一种螺旋-转角-螺旋变体基序。由11个残基组成的“转角”区域形成一个RNA聚合酶接触位点。
